‘Vocabulary’
- Boulder (noun)
Meaning: a large rock, typically one that has been worn smooth by erosion. (कंकर)
Synonyms: rock, stone, gibber
Sentence: He sat down on a boulder.
- Antagonism (noun)
Meaning: active hostility or opposition. (विरोध)
Synonyms: hostility, friction, enmity
Antonyms: friendship, goodwill, amity
Sentence: The antagonism between them.
- Appease (verb)
Meaning: pacify or placate (someone) by acceding to their demands. (तुष्ट करना)
Synonyms: conciliate, placate, pacify
Antonyms: anger, enrage, incense
Sentence: Amendments have been added to appease local pressure groups.
- Unenviable (adj.)
Meaning: difficult, undesirable, or unpleasant. (अवांछनीय)
Synonyms: disagreeable, unpleasant, undesirable
Antonyms: charming, enchanting, fascinating
Sentence: Cooper had the unenviable job of announcing the redundancies.

- Erudite (adj.)
Meaning: having or showing great knowledge or learning. (वैज्ञानिक)
Synonyms: learned, scholarly, well educated
Antonyms: illiterate, uneducated, unlearned
Sentence: He could turn any conversation into an erudite discussion.
- Tedious (adj.)
Meaning: too long, slow, or dull; tiresome or monotonous. (थकानेवाला)
Synonyms: boring, monotonous, dull
Antonyms: engaging, engrossing, gripping
Sentence: It gets tedious, but I get a kick out of doing it that way.
- Perversity (noun)
Meaning: a deliberate desire to behave in an unreasonable or unacceptable way; contrariness. (प्रतिकूलता)
Synonyms: contrariness, perverseness, awkwardness
Antonyms: amiability, serenity
Sentence: She’s marrying him out of sheer perversity.
- Veracity (noun)
Meaning: conformity to facts; accuracy. (सच्चाई)
Synonyms: truthfulness, truth, accuracy
Antonyms: deceit, dishonesty, lying
Sentence: Officials expressed doubts concerning the veracity of the story.
- Moiety (noun)
Meaning: each of two parts into which a thing is or can be divided. (आधा भाग)
Synonyms: half, moiety, part
Antonyms: entirety, whole, full
Sentence: The tax was to be delivered in two moieties.
